Abstract

The utility model discloses a kind of off-gas recovery reuse means for smelting furnace, it includes burner hearth;The side of burner hearth is equipped with heat exchange box I, heat exchange box II and heat exchange box III;Heat exchange box I, heat exchange box II and heat exchange box III are connected to by burner with burner hearth respectively, and burner is connected to by the gas pipeline with gas valve with fuel cartridge respectively;Heat exchange box I, heat exchange box II and heat exchange box III are connected to main air inlet pipe respectively;The front end of main air inlet pipe is equipped with air blower;Heat exchange box I, heat exchange box II and heat exchange box III are connected to smoke evacuation supervisor respectively;Smoke evacuation supervisor is equipped with throttling smoke pipe, and the smoke pipe that throttles is connected to by throttle valve with main air inlet pipe.Off-gas recovery preheats high-temperature flue gas to the air in main air inlet pipe by throttling smoke pipe, and respectively enters in heat exchange box I, II, III, exchange hot-bulb heating;Throttle valve into main intake stack, reuses 30% to 40% smoke backflow, and section has lacked the dosage of new compressed air, burns and sufficiently decomposes again.

Technical field
The utility model belongs to aluminium ingot melting corollary equipment technical field, and in particular to a kind of cigarette for molten aluminum smelting furnace Gas recycling and reusing device.
Background technique
In the prior art, smelting furnace can generate high-temperature flue gas in melting molten aluminum, and traditional fume treatment mode is to pass through Flue gas is introduced purification device by pipeline, is discharged again after purification.
In the specific use process, insufficient, imperfect combustion flue gas warp of the flue gas in smelting furnace due to burning Crossing purification will increase subsequent processing load, meanwhile, the air injected into smelting furnace is also required to by preheating to reduce temperature Difference improves efficiency of combustion.
Therefore, how the flue gas in smelting furnace to be recycled again, the purification efficiency of Lai Tigao flue gas simultaneously can also be right Air carries out preheating and improves efficiency of combustion, is a problem urgently to be solved.
Summary of the invention
The purpose of this utility model is that the solution prior art is difficult to control there are molten aluminum flow and unhandy technology is asked Topic, provides a kind of off-gas recovery reuse means for smelting furnace, with overcome the deficiencies in the prior art.
To achieve the goals above, a kind of off-gas recovery reuse means for smelting furnace of the utility model, it includes Burner hearth;
The side of the burner hearth is equipped with heat exchange box I, heat exchange box II and heat exchange box III;It the heat exchange box I, heat exchange box II and changes Hot tank III is interconnected by burner and burner hearth respectively, and burner passes through gas pipeline with gas valve and combustion gas respectively Tank is interconnected;
The heat exchange box I, heat exchange box II and heat exchange box III pass through blast pipe and main air inlet pipe phase with air valve respectively It is intercommunicated;The front end of the main air inlet pipe is equipped with air blower;The heat exchange box I, heat exchange box II and heat exchange box III pass through band respectively The fume pipe and smoke evacuation supervisor for having exhaust smoke valve are interconnected;Its main points is that the smoke evacuation supervisor is equipped with the section interconnected with it Smoke pipe is flowed, and the smoke pipe that throttles is interconnected by throttle valve and main air inlet pipe.
The utility model is structurally reasonable, and the off-gas recovery in smoke evacuation supervisor can be made high-temperature flue gas to master by throttling smoke pipe Air in air inlet pipe is preheated, and is finally respectively enterd in heat exchange box I, heat exchange box II and heat exchange box III, so as to heat exchanging Ball is heated;Throttle valve into main intake stack, reuses 30% to 40% smoke backflow;Off-gas recovery utilizes, section The dosage of new compressed air is lacked;The harmful substance in flue gas is sufficiently decomposed through burning again simultaneously, reduces subsequent environmental protection The operational pressure of facility.
Advantage: 1, two aspect of energy conservation: 1) flue gas waste heat part itself re-uses, 2) thermal energy of smoke combustion passes through accumulation of heat Case accumulation of heat re-uses, and reaches energy conservation.
2, flue gas repeated combustion reaches clean-burning, reduces discharge of poisonous waste.
